Bill Gates has finally confirmed his new romance with his ‘serious girlfriend’ just weeks after he revealed that his divorce from ex-wife Melinda French Gates was his worst mistake ever

The former tech power couple tied the knot in 1994, welcomed three kids into the world and then divorced in May of 2021 after 27 years of marriage.
Since then, 69-year-old Bill has been spotted several times throughout the last few years with 62-year-old Paula Hurd, the widow of former Oracle CEO Mark Hurd.
But it wasn’t until Tuesday where the billionaire co-founder of Microsoft got candid about his love life during an appearance on The Today Show.
‘I’m lucky to have a serious girlfriend named Paula,’ he said. ‘So we’re having fun, going to the Olympics and lots of great things.’
During the appearance, Bill discussed his new memoir, Source Code: My Beginnings – an origin story about his life and the early days of Microsoft which was published on Tuesday.
The influential business leader also dropped a special shoutout to Hurd in the ending acknowledgements, calling her a ‘thoughtful friend.’

‘Early readers of the manuscript included Paula Hurd, Marc St. John and Sheila Gulati,’ the memoir read.
‘The close read from dear and trusted friends provided much-needed thoughtful and insightful feedback at critical stages in writing.’
Bill’s declaration of his newly found love came less than a month after he divulged his shattered relationship with 60-year-old Melinda, calling the unexpected divorce ‘the mistake I most regret.’
‘I’m more cheerful now,’ Bill said during an interview with British newspaper The Times in December. ‘That was the mistake I most regret.’
Once a tech executive herself, Hurd is now an event planner and organizer, and philanthropist.
